Is Microneedling Right For You?

Microneedling is a popular cosmetic procedure that utilizes tiny needles to create controlled punctures in the skin. These micro-injuries stimulate collagen and elastin production, resulting to smoother, firmer skin. That said, microneedling isn't right for everyone.

  • Think about undergoing microneedling, it's important to discuss with a qualified dermatologist or plastic surgeon.
  • A doctor can evaluate your skin type and concerns to see if microneedling is a good option for you.
  • Furthermore, be aware of potential risks such as redness, swelling, and mild bruising.

Microneedling can be a beneficial treatment for various skin conditions, including acne scars, fine lines, and wrinkles. Nevertheless, it's crucial to choose a reputable provider who uses sterile techniques and high-quality equipment to avoid the risk of infection or other complications.

Microneedling: The Science Behind Its Success

Microneedling has emerged as a popular skincare treatment, promising noticeable results for various skin concerns. But what exactly underlies this transformative procedure? The science behind microneedling is fascinating and involves the strategic formation of tiny punctures in the skin's surface. These micro-injuries, precisely controlled by a device containing fine needles, activate the skin's natural repair process.

As a result an increased production of collagen and elastin, the essential proteins responsible for skin's firmness. This enhanced fibrous network effectively smooths the appearance of fine lines, wrinkles, acne scars, and other skin imperfections, leaving your skin looking healthier.

Furthermore, microneedling can also enhance the absorption of skincare products by creating a pathway for deeper infiltration.
